About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

Technical Specifications
Side-by-side comparison of Radeon HD 7570M/HD 7670M and Intel UHD Graphics 615

Radeon HD 7570M/HD 7670M
The Radeon HD 7570M/HD 7670M is manufactured by AMD. It was released in October 13 2009. It features the TeraScale 2 architecture. The core clock speed is 850 MHz. It has 800 shading units. The thermal design power (TDP) is 108W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 699 points. Launch price was $159.

Intel UHD Graphics 615
The Intel UHD Graphics 615 is manufactured by Intel. It was released in November 7 2018. It features the Generation 9.5 architecture. The core clock ranges from 300 MHz to 1050 MHz. It has 192 shading units. The thermal design power (TDP) is 15W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 717 points.
